You have to be a member of the IWLA Rockville Chapter or be the guest of a member in order to use the pistol, rifle, and archery range. Annual Membership fee is 110 USD plus a one time initiation fee. You also have to do 8 hours of volunteer work every year.
At the pistol range you may place targets at 7 yards, 50 feet, 25 yards and 50 yards. You may also shoot rifles of certain limited calibers. Pistol caliber rifles are OK. In bottlenecks, under .223/5.56 will work so long as your cartridge fits within a jig at the range. When it comes to straight-walled rounds,. .30 carbine is OK. All shotgun gauges as long as it's slugs, no bird or buck. Download the range rules from the website for details.
